Your bridal jewelry should complement and enhance your overall wedding day look. For some brides, this means opting for statement diamond earrings. But at other times, understatement is a better choice. How can you decide which to go with? Here are a few dos and don'ts.
Do Use Statement Earrings Alone
In general, if you opt for statement earrings, avoid other large statement pieces. A large and intricate necklace with a V-neck dress and a set of diamond chandelier earrings can easily overpower one another.
